fix fe+ & 5dim's

This commit is contained in:
Brevven 2022-02-16 21:29:54 -08:00
parent 89a07a8a70
commit 8ab69a27f2
7 changed files with 19 additions and 14 deletions

View file

@ -1,4 +1,9 @@
---------------------------------------------------------------------------------------------------
Version: 1.0.6
Date: 2022-02-16
Fixes:
- Fix for FE+ and 5dim's used together.
---------------------------------------------------------------------------------------------------
Version: 1.0.5
Date: 2022-02-11
Fixes:

View file

@ -558,7 +558,7 @@ function util.add_crafting_category(entity_type, entity, category)
if data.raw[entity_type][entity] then
for i, existing in pairs(data.raw[entity_type][entity].crafting_categories) do
if existing == category then
log(entity.." not adding "..new.." -- duplicate")
log(entity.." not adding "..category.." -- duplicate")
return
end
end

View file

@ -1,6 +1,6 @@
{
"name": "bztitanium",
"version": "1.0.5",
"version": "1.0.6",
"factorio_version": "1.1",
"title": "Titanium",
"author": "Brevven",

View file

@ -8,16 +8,16 @@ if simpleCompress then
end
if simpleCompress.plates then
simpleCompress.currentSubgroup = "intermediate-product"
if data.raw.item["titanium-plate"] then
SimpleCompress_AddTintedItem("titanium-plate", "plates4-titanium", "plate3", {r=0.85, g=0.85, b=0.70})
SimpleCompress_UnlockPlateTechAndRecipe("titanium-plate")
if data.raw.item[util.me.titanium_plate] then
SimpleCompress_AddTintedItem(util.me.titanium_plate, "plates4-titanium", "plate3", {r=0.85, g=0.85, b=0.70})
SimpleCompress_UnlockPlateTechAndRecipe(util.me.titanium_plate)
end
local titaniumRecipe = data.raw.recipe["decompress-titanium-plate"]
titaniumRecipe.order = "d[titanium-plate]"
end
if simpleCompress.smelting then
if data.raw.item["titanium-plate"] and data.raw.item["titanium-plate"] then
SimpleCompress_AddSmeltingRecipe("titanium-ore", "titanium-plate")
if data.raw.item[ util.me.titanium_plate] and data.raw.item[util.me.titanium_plate] then
SimpleCompress_AddSmeltingRecipe("titanium-ore",util.me.titanium_plate)
SimpleCompress_UnlockOreSmeltingTech("titanium-ore")
local titaniumRecipe = data.raw.recipe["smelt-compressed-titanium-ore"]
titaniumRecipe.ingredients = {{"compressed-titanium-ore", 5}}

View file

@ -69,7 +69,7 @@ data:extend(
{
{"enriched-titanium", 10}
},
result = "titanium-plate",
result = util.me.titanium_plate,
result_count = 5,
order = "b[titanium-plate]-b[enriched-titanium-plate]"
},

View file

@ -49,7 +49,7 @@ matter.createMatterRecipe(titanium_ore_matter)
local titanium_plate_matter =
{
item_name = "titanium-plate",
item_name = util.me.titanium_plate,
minimum_conversion_quantity = 10,
matter_value = 14,
energy_required = 2,

View file

@ -2,8 +2,8 @@ local util = require("__bztitanium__.data-util");
if mods["5dim_core"] then
data.raw.item["titanium-plate"].subgroup = "plates-plates"
data.raw.recipe["titanium-plate"].subgroup = "plates-plates"
data.raw.item[util.me.titanium_plate].subgroup = "plates-plates"
data.raw.recipe[util.me.titanium_plate].subgroup = "plates-plates"
data.raw.item["titanium-ore"].subgroup = "plates-ore"
if mods["5dim_resources"] then
@ -95,7 +95,7 @@ if mods["5dim_core"] then
if mods["5dim_automation"] then
for i, name in ipairs(
{"5d-assembling-machine-07","5d-assembling-machine-08","5d-lab-06","5d-lab-07"}) do
util.replace_ingredient(name, "steel-plate", "titanium-plate")
util.replace_ingredient(name, "steel-plate", util.me.titanium_plate)
end
end
@ -113,12 +113,12 @@ if mods["5dim_core"] then
"5d-steam-turbine-09",
"5d-steam-turbine-10"
}) do
util.add_ingredient(name, "titanium-plate", 20)
util.add_ingredient(name, util.me.titanium_plate, 20)
end
end
if mods["5dim_battlefield"] then
util.replace_ingredient(name, "steel-plate", "titanium-plate")
util.replace_ingredient(name, "steel-plate", util.me.titanium_plate)
end
end